版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
實時數(shù)據(jù)交換性能優(yōu)化方案實時數(shù)據(jù)交換性能優(yōu)化方案一、實時數(shù)據(jù)交換性能優(yōu)化的技術(shù)路徑實時數(shù)據(jù)交換性能優(yōu)化是提升系統(tǒng)響應(yīng)速度、降低延遲的關(guān)鍵環(huán)節(jié),需從技術(shù)架構(gòu)、協(xié)議選擇、數(shù)據(jù)處理等多維度切入。(一)高效通信協(xié)議的選型與優(yōu)化通信協(xié)議的選擇直接影響數(shù)據(jù)傳輸效率。傳統(tǒng)協(xié)議如HTTP/1.1存在隊頭阻塞問題,而HTTP/2通過多路復用和頭部壓縮顯著提升性能;QUIC協(xié)議進一步解決丟包重傳延遲,適合高丟包率場景。優(yōu)化方向包括:1.協(xié)議參數(shù)調(diào)優(yōu):調(diào)整TCP窗口大小、啟用快速重傳機制,減少網(wǎng)絡(luò)抖動影響。2.自定義協(xié)議設(shè)計:針對特定業(yè)務(wù)場景(如高頻小數(shù)據(jù)包)設(shè)計二進制協(xié)議,減少冗余字段。3.協(xié)議兼容性適配:通過網(wǎng)關(guān)層實現(xiàn)新舊協(xié)議轉(zhuǎn)換,確保異構(gòu)系統(tǒng)無縫對接。(二)數(shù)據(jù)壓縮與序列化技術(shù)應(yīng)用減少傳輸數(shù)據(jù)量是性能優(yōu)化的核心。需平衡壓縮率與計算開銷:1.無損壓縮算法選擇:Snappy、LZ4適用于實時性要求高的場景;Zstandard提供更高壓縮比,適合帶寬敏感場景。2.序列化格式優(yōu)化:ProtocolBuffers和FlatBuffers相比JSON減少80%體積;Avro支持動態(tài)Schema,適合數(shù)據(jù)格式頻繁變更場景。3.增量傳輸機制:僅同步差異數(shù)據(jù)(如BSDiff算法),降低全量傳輸頻率。(三)分布式緩存與內(nèi)存管理策略緩存設(shè)計直接影響數(shù)據(jù)交換實時性:1.多級緩存架構(gòu):本地緩存(Caffeine)+分布式緩存(Redis)組合,減少網(wǎng)絡(luò)IO。2.熱點數(shù)據(jù)預(yù)加載:基于歷史訪問模式預(yù)測熱點Key,提前加載至邊緣節(jié)點。3.內(nèi)存池化技術(shù):通過Netty的ByteBuf或JEMalloc避免頻繁內(nèi)存分配,降低GC停頓。二、實時數(shù)據(jù)交換性能優(yōu)化的系統(tǒng)架構(gòu)設(shè)計系統(tǒng)級優(yōu)化需從整體架構(gòu)層面解決性能瓶頸,涉及流量調(diào)度、容錯機制等方面。(一)邊緣計算與數(shù)據(jù)分片策略1.邊緣節(jié)點部署:將計算能力下沉至CDN節(jié)點,實現(xiàn)地理就近訪問(如CloudflareWorkers)。2.一致性哈希分片:確保數(shù)據(jù)均勻分布,節(jié)點擴容時僅需遷移少量數(shù)據(jù)。3.動態(tài)分片調(diào)整:基于實時負載監(jiān)控自動拆分熱點分片(如Elasticsearch路由機制)。(二)異步化與背壓控制機制1.反應(yīng)式編程模型:采用Reactor或Akka實現(xiàn)非阻塞管道,線程利用率提升40%以上。2.流量整形算法:令牌桶算法限制突發(fā)流量,漏桶算法平滑輸出速率。3.分級降級策略:定義核心/非核心數(shù)據(jù)優(yōu)先級,過載時自動丟棄低優(yōu)先級數(shù)據(jù)。(三)全鏈路監(jiān)控與動態(tài)調(diào)優(yōu)1.端到端追蹤系統(tǒng):集成OpenTelemetry采集網(wǎng)絡(luò)延遲、序列化耗時等指標。2.自適應(yīng)參數(shù)調(diào)整:基于強化學習動態(tài)優(yōu)化TCP緩沖區(qū)大小、重試超時閾值。3.故障自愈能力:通過混沌工程驗證熔斷策略有效性,如NetflixHystrix規(guī)則配置。三、實時數(shù)據(jù)交換性能優(yōu)化的實踐案例不同行業(yè)在實時數(shù)據(jù)交換優(yōu)化中積累了差異化經(jīng)驗,具有重要參考價值。(一)金融行業(yè)低延遲交易系統(tǒng)實踐1.FPGA加速方案:摩根大通使用FPGA硬件解析FIX協(xié)議,延遲降至微秒級。2.內(nèi)核旁路技術(shù):Solarflare網(wǎng)卡支持KernelBypass,減少操作系統(tǒng)上下文切換。3.時鐘同步優(yōu)化:通過PTP協(xié)議實現(xiàn)納秒級時間同步,確保跨機房時序一致性。(二)物聯(lián)網(wǎng)海量設(shè)備接入方案1.MQTT協(xié)議優(yōu)化:特斯拉車聯(lián)網(wǎng)采用QoS1+消息去重機制,保障99.99%投遞率。2.連接池化管理:AWSIoTCore使用多路復用技術(shù),單服務(wù)器支撐百萬級連接。3.邊緣過濾規(guī)則:西門子工業(yè)網(wǎng)關(guān)部署Lua腳本預(yù)處理數(shù)據(jù),減少云端計算壓力。(三)互聯(lián)網(wǎng)實時推薦系統(tǒng)優(yōu)化1.增量學習架構(gòu):字節(jié)跳動推薦系統(tǒng)每小時更新模型參數(shù),僅同步權(quán)重差異。2.向量化傳輸:將特征向量轉(zhuǎn)換為SIMD指令優(yōu)化格式,提升特征解碼速度。3.分級訂閱機制:Netflix根據(jù)用戶設(shè)備性能動態(tài)調(diào)整數(shù)據(jù)推送質(zhì)量(如H.264vsAV1)。四、實時數(shù)據(jù)交換性能優(yōu)化的硬件與網(wǎng)絡(luò)層優(yōu)化硬件與網(wǎng)絡(luò)基礎(chǔ)設(shè)施是實時數(shù)據(jù)交換的底層支撐,其優(yōu)化直接影響整體性能上限。(一)高性能網(wǎng)絡(luò)設(shè)備選型與配置1.智能網(wǎng)卡(SmartNIC)應(yīng)用:通過卸載TCP/IP協(xié)議棧至網(wǎng)卡(如NVIDIABlueField),降低CPU負載,提升吞吐量30%以上。2.RDMA(遠程直接內(nèi)存訪問)技術(shù):在金融高頻交易場景中,RoCEv2協(xié)議實現(xiàn)微秒級延遲,避免內(nèi)核態(tài)數(shù)據(jù)拷貝。3.網(wǎng)絡(luò)拓撲優(yōu)化:采用Clos架構(gòu)構(gòu)建無阻塞網(wǎng)絡(luò),結(jié)合ECMP(等價多路徑路由)實現(xiàn)流量均衡。(二)服務(wù)器硬件加速技術(shù)1.GPU/FPGA異構(gòu)計算:在實時視頻分析場景,利用NVIDIATensorRT加速數(shù)據(jù)編解碼,處理延遲降低至毫秒級。2.持久內(nèi)存(PMEM)應(yīng)用:英特爾Optane持久內(nèi)存作為寫入緩沖區(qū),解決Kafka等消息隊列的磁盤IO瓶頸。3.NUMA架構(gòu)調(diào)優(yōu):通過numactl綁定進程與內(nèi)存節(jié)點,減少跨NUMA節(jié)點訪問帶來的延遲波動。(三)網(wǎng)絡(luò)傳輸層深度優(yōu)化1.TCP/UDP協(xié)議棧調(diào)優(yōu):調(diào)整Linux內(nèi)核參數(shù)(如net.ipv4.tcp_tw_reuse)、啟用BBR擁塞控制算法,提升跨國傳輸穩(wěn)定性。2.多網(wǎng)卡綁定(Bonding):采用LACP模式實現(xiàn)鏈路聚合,單節(jié)點帶寬提升至40Gbps以上。3.5G網(wǎng)絡(luò)切片技術(shù):工業(yè)物聯(lián)網(wǎng)場景中,為關(guān)鍵數(shù)據(jù)分配專屬網(wǎng)絡(luò)切片,保障傳輸QoS。五、實時數(shù)據(jù)交換性能優(yōu)化的軟件架構(gòu)創(chuàng)新軟件層面的架構(gòu)革新能夠突破傳統(tǒng)性能瓶頸,需結(jié)合最新技術(shù)趨勢進行設(shè)計。(一)事件驅(qū)動架構(gòu)與流處理引擎1.復雜事件處理(CEP)引擎:ApacheFlink實現(xiàn)毫秒級窗口計算,支持動態(tài)調(diào)整時間窗口大小。2.數(shù)據(jù)流水線并行化:采用Actor模型(如AkkaStream)構(gòu)建異步處理鏈,吞吐量提升5-8倍。3.狀態(tài)管理優(yōu)化:RocksDB本地狀態(tài)存儲+定期Checkpoint機制,平衡性能與容錯需求。(二)微服務(wù)與Serverless架構(gòu)適配1.服務(wù)網(wǎng)格(ServiceMesh)優(yōu)化:Istio鏈路級熔斷配置,避免級聯(lián)故障影響實時數(shù)據(jù)流。2.函數(shù)計算冷啟動加速:AWSLambdaSnapStart技術(shù)將Java函數(shù)啟動時間從6秒縮短至200毫秒。3.微服務(wù)粒度設(shè)計:按數(shù)據(jù)變更頻率拆分服務(wù),高頻服務(wù)部署(如訂單狀態(tài)服務(wù))。(三)新型數(shù)據(jù)庫與存儲方案1.時序數(shù)據(jù)庫優(yōu)化:InfluxDB的TSM存儲引擎壓縮比達10:1,支持每秒百萬級數(shù)據(jù)點寫入。2.內(nèi)存數(shù)據(jù)庫持久化:RedisRDB+AOF混合持久化策略,故障恢復時間控制在30秒內(nèi)。3.分布式日志存儲:ApachePulsar分層存儲(Hot/Warm/Cold)降低SSD存儲成本60%。六、實時數(shù)據(jù)交換性能優(yōu)化的安全與合規(guī)平衡性能優(yōu)化需兼顧安全要求,尤其在金融、醫(yī)療等強監(jiān)管領(lǐng)域。(一)加密傳輸?shù)男阅軗p耗優(yōu)化1.硬件加速加密:IntelQAT加速卡支持TLS1.3握手,RSA2048簽名速度提升20倍。2.輕量級加密算法:ChaCha20-Poly1305在移動端比AES-GCM節(jié)省30%CPU資源。3.會話復用機制:TLS會話票據(jù)(SessionTicket)減少重復密鑰協(xié)商開銷。(二)數(shù)據(jù)隱私保護技術(shù)集成1.差分隱私實時計算:Google的PipelineDP框架在流數(shù)據(jù)中注入噪聲,隱私保護與數(shù)據(jù)效用平衡。2.字段級脫敏傳輸:信用卡號等敏感字段在網(wǎng)關(guān)層脫敏,僅目標系統(tǒng)獲取完整數(shù)據(jù)。3.零信任網(wǎng)絡(luò)訪問:CloudflareTunnel建立加密隧道,避免傳統(tǒng)VPN的性能瓶頸。(三)審計與合規(guī)性保障1.不可篡改日志技術(shù):基于區(qū)塊鏈的審計日志(如HyperledgerFabric),寫入延遲控制在500ms內(nèi)。2.實時合規(guī)檢查引擎:FlinkCEP引擎檢測交易數(shù)據(jù)流是否符合MiFIDII規(guī)定。3.數(shù)據(jù)主權(quán)解決方案:通過HashiCorpConsul實現(xiàn)跨地域數(shù)據(jù)路由,滿足GDPR本地化要求??偨Y(jié)實時數(shù)據(jù)交換性能優(yōu)化是一個涵蓋硬件、網(wǎng)絡(luò)、軟件、安全等多維度的系統(tǒng)工程。在硬件層面,通過智能網(wǎng)卡、RDMA、GPU加速等技術(shù)突破物理性能限制;在網(wǎng)絡(luò)傳輸層,采用協(xié)議棧調(diào)優(yōu)、5G切片等方法提升傳輸效率;軟件架構(gòu)上,事件驅(qū)動設(shè)
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2026年上海市浦東新區(qū)人民醫(yī)院招聘備考題庫及答案詳解1套
- 2026年北京北航天宇長鷹無人機科技有限公司招聘備考題庫及完整答案詳解1套
- 2026年山東師范大學公開招聘人員7人備考題庫及答案詳解1套
- 2026年國電投(天津)電力有限公司招聘備考題庫及一套參考答案詳解
- 2026年南開醫(yī)院收費員外包崗位(北方輔醫(yī)外包項目)招聘備考題庫及一套參考答案詳解
- 2026年安徽安東捷氪玻璃科技有限公司招聘備考題庫及1套完整答案詳解
- 2026年中電云腦(天津)科技有限公司招聘備考題庫有答案詳解
- 企業(yè)機械內(nèi)控制度
- 匯豐銀行內(nèi)控制度
- 出入境收費內(nèi)控制度
- 漫畫委托創(chuàng)作協(xié)議書
- (2025年)功能性消化不良中西醫(yī)結(jié)合診療專家共識解讀課件
- 人教版(PEP)四年級上學期英語期末卷(含答案)
- 員工代收工資協(xié)議書
- 協(xié)會捐贈協(xié)議書范本
- 人員轉(zhuǎn)簽實施方案
- C強制認證培訓資料課件
- 2025秋南方新課堂金牌學案中國歷史七年級上冊(配人教版)(教師用書)
- 高中數(shù)學建模競賽試題及答案
- 體育場所知識培訓內(nèi)容課件
- 奧諾康多烯酸軟膠囊課件
評論
0/150
提交評論